摘要
The blends of primary alcohols and organo-lead trihalide perovskite (OLTP) precursor solutions with the stoichiometry ABX(3) (A = MA(+) or FA(+); B = Pb2+; X = Cl-, Br- or I-) lead to a significant reduction in their retrograde solubilities, which enables a temperature-reduced crystallisation pathway to grow high-quality single crystals.
